Backset
Webster's Dictionary
(1):
(n.) Whatever is thrown back in its course, as water.
(2):
(n.) A check; a relapse; a discouragement; a setback.
(3):
(v. i.) To plow again, in the fall; - said of prairie land broken up in the spring.
